9. Joy Division

I couldn’t really decide on which album to choose by Joy Division because to choose one is to exclude the other. I kind of listen to it all together. If I listen to one album I’ll listen to the second album. Joy Division are one of those bands where you remember the first time you heard it. I was 15 years old and was visiting my brother who had just come back from college and had an apartment in Portland. It was a safe place to go because my parents trusted him, he’d been to college, he was an adult and he would be my supervision. But what they didn’t know is that I would go over there to drink and get high. He was always very protective and made sure I was safe but I went there to do all that. One of his roommates had a tape that had ‘Love Will Tear Us Apart’ on it and I was overwhelmed. I thought, "Who is this band? What is this? I have to have it." I actually stole the tape from him.

I was into Joy Division when I was younger, and that whole time period, that scene of bands like them, New Order, Siouxsie & The Banshees, etc. Then over the years you listen to other things and over time you almost forget about your favourite band because they’re always just there, you don’t need to listen to them every day. But then for some reason you get reminded of them and you remember that you love that band.

And with Joy Division, there’s something about them. Every time I listen to a Joy Division song I have a very emotional reaction. Honestly I could listen to it forever, all day every day. No matter how long I go without hearing them, as soon as I hear a couple of notes of a song I’m right back there with that feeling of being a little overwhelmed.

If I had to pick one album though, I’d pick Closer. ‘Heart And Soul’ is probably my favourite Joy Division song. It’s really weird.
